Guava belongs to Tree Fruit, Tropical category whereas Tamarind belongs to Tropical category. Guava originated in Central America, Mexico and South America while Tamarind originated in Africa.

Guava and Tamarind Varieties

Guava and Tamarind varieties form an important part of Guava vs Tamarind characteristics. Due to advancements and development in the field of horticulture science, it is possible to get many varieties of Guava and Tamarind. The varieties of Guava are Lucknow 49, Allahabad Safeda, Chittidar, Harijha, Apple guava, Hafshi, Arka Mridula and Allahabad Surkha whereas the varieties of Tamarind are PKM 1, Urigam, Hasanur, Tumkur prathisthan, DTS 1 and Yogeshwari. The shape of Guava and Tamarind is Round and Curving Cylinder respecitely. Talking about the taste, Guava is sweet-sour in taste and Tamarind is sour-sweet.
